The Government of India is taking major steps to encourage more women to join science and technology. Union Minister Dr. Jitendra Singh recently shared the details in the Rajya Sabha about women and engineering-casting (Wise-Ciran) scheme in women. This initiative of the Department of Science and Technology (DST) aims to support women scientists, researchers and entrepreneurs through fellowships, training and funding.

Benefits of women’s stem initiative
- Increase in research participation: More than 2,076 female scientists benefited under WOS-A, with 5,000+ research papers published.
- Skill development: IPR training increases employment; 40% WOS-C trainees are now registered patent agents.
- Career continuity: Fellowship helps women to pursue PhD and postdorel research without financial obstacles.
- Entrepreneurship growth: Nidhi and TBIS support women -led startups with funding and incubation.
- Early Stem Engagement: Vigyan Jyoti inspired young girls to take stem career.
- Institutional Reforms: Gati ensures gender equality in research organizations.
- Biotech and Innovation Leadership: Biocare and Wise-IPR strong women in high-tech areas.
